Fans now have answers about Ozzy Osbourne’s cause of death, two weeks after the legendary rocker passed away. The Black Sabbath frontman died on July 22 at the age of 76, leaving behind a legacy that defined heavy metal for decades. His passing sparked tributes from around the world, with fans and fellow musicians celebrating the impact of his music.

According to The New York Times, Ozzy Osbourne’s cause of death was cardiac arrest, acute myocardial infarction, coronary artery disease, and complications from Parkinson’s disease. His family shared that he spent his final moments surrounded by loved ones, a small comfort during such a devastating loss.
